How to Apply for the Bank of America Premium Rewards Card

In premium travel rewards, the Bank of America Premium Rewards Card stays attractive because the earn structure is simple and the annual fee remains modest. 

Expect 2 points per dollar on travel and dining, 1.5 points on everything else, and 60,000 online bonus points after meeting the initial spend requirement, according to current issuer materials checked on November 19, 2025.

Application and benefit details should always be verified on the official pages, since rates, fees, and offers can change without notice. Current issuer pages also confirm no foreign transaction fees, making this card practical for international trips.

Eligibility and What to Prepare

Strong applications present consistent identity, residency, and income information across the form and any follow-up verification. Bank of America’s application FAQs note that online decisions can appear quickly, and that card delivery typically follows within about 7 to 10 business days after approval. 

The issuer explicitly asks for a Social Security number and total gross annual income in the online credit card application flow. Applicants who need to check a pending decision can use the bank’s online Application Status page or call the listed number.

International readers often ask about identification numbers. IRS guidance explains that an Individual Taxpayer Identification Number (ITIN) is for federal tax purposes and does not convey immigration or work authorization; some U.S. banks accept ITINs for in-person applications.

Rewards and Credits Explained

Issuer copy highlights the welcome offer, the ongoing earn rates, and two travel-related statement credits. Materials show 60,000 online bonus points after at least 4,000 dollars in purchases within the first 90 days of account opening. 

Ongoing earn remains unlimited at 2 points per dollar on travel and dining and 1.5 points per dollar on all other purchases. 

Program language also underscores that points do not expire while the account remains open and that multiple redemption options exist, including cash back to eligible Bank of America and Merrill accounts or travel bookings via the Bank of America Travel Center.

Travel Credits Deserve Precise Framing

Bank of America’s benefit pages indicate up to 100 dollars in airline incidental statement credit each year for qualifying charges like seat upgrades or checked bags, plus up to 100 dollars in airport security fee credits every four years for a TSA PreCheck credit benefit or a Global Entry fee credit

Marketing copy sometimes presents those two as “up to 200 dollars in combined statement credits,” although only the airline incidental portion refreshes annually.

How to Apply Online

A few clean steps help avoid stalled decisions and follow-up document requests. Plan five to ten minutes for the form, then keep your phone handy in case of immediate verification.

Step-By-Step Application: 

  1. Start at the official Premium Rewards page and choose Apply; pre-screened or customized offer links can also be used if available.
  2. Complete identity, contact, housing, and employment fields, then enter Social Security number and total gross annual income exactly as they appear on file and pay documents.
  3. Review rates and fees disclosures, confirm consent, and submit the application.
  4. Capture the reference number from the decision screen; pending cases can be checked through the Application Status tool.
  5. After approval, activate the card on arrival and set up mobile banking for alerts and virtual card controls.

In-Branch Applications and Timeline

Complex profiles or recent U.S. arrivals sometimes prefer a financial center visit for documentation review. Expect a similar form completed with a banker, plus potential identity checks on additional documents where warranted.

In-Branch

Bring government-issued identification, a tax identification number, and proof of U.S. address if available. 

Bank of America’s public guidance for international clients references the need for two forms of ID and both U.S. and foreign addresses when opening accounts in person; similar Know-Your-Customer standards apply to credit products. 

Delivery typically occurs within 7 to 10 business days following approval, matching the online fulfillment timeline.

Preferred Rewards Multiplier and Who Benefits

Relationship bonuses can materially improve point earnings for depositors and investors at Bank of America and Merrill. 

Official pages confirm Bank of America Preferred Rewards members receive a 25 percent, 50 percent, or 75 percent bonus on eligible card purchases, based on tier. Those tiers depend on combined average daily balances and are reviewed monthly for upgrades after enrollment. 

Frequent travelers who consistently charge airfare, hotels, rides, and dining can see the effective earn rate rise from 2 points to as high as 3.5 points on travel and dining once bonuses apply.

Fees, APR, and Key Terms

Issuer disclosures list the annual fee, ongoing APR range, balance transfer fee, and foreign transaction policy for this product. Details below were checked for accuracy on November 19, 2025, and can change without notice; always recheck the live pages immediately before applying.

Item Current disclosure
Annual fee 95 dollars
Purchase APR variable APR 19.74% to 27.74%
Intro APR None
Balance transfer fee 4 percent of each transaction
Foreign transaction fee no foreign transaction fees

Using and Redeeming Points Effectively

Official copy emphasizes flexible choices, including cash back as a deposit to Bank of America checking or savings, a credit to eligible Merrill accounts, statement credits, and travel bookings through the Bank of America Travel Center

Third-party analyses frequently value these points at about one cent each for travel and cash-equivalent uses, although actual value depends on the redemption chosen and any promotions.

Preferred Rewards members should evaluate where spending falls across dining, airfare, hotels, and everyday categories. Households concentrating travel and dining spend on this card while maintaining higher relationship tiers can increase effective earn rates meaningfully, especially during peak travel periods.

Quick Document Checklist for Smooth Approvals

Short preparation prevents avoidable delays and follow-up calls.

  • Government-issued ID that matches application details; keep digital copies secure.
  • Social Security number or ITIN, where applicable; ensure numbers match tax records.
  • Recent income information, such as pay stubs or award letters, is needed for accurate totals.
  • Current U.S. address and contact information for delivery and verification.
  • Bank of America Online Banking credentials if applying while signed in.

After Submitting: Status, Activation, and Security

Pending decisions can be checked online through the status center or by phone. Approved accounts receive cards within the typical 7 to 10 business-day window; activation can be done in the mobile app, on the web, or by phone. 

The issuer’s security guidance recommends monitoring account alerts, locking the card if it’s misplaced, and contacting support if suspicious messages appear.

Practical Pitfalls to Avoid

Mismatched names and addresses across identification, application, and banking profiles frequently trigger manual reviews. Claims about airline incidental statement credit usage should match eligible charge types, since gift cards and airfare purchases usually do not qualify. 

Airport security fee credits refresh on a four-year cycle, so applications for TSA PreCheck credit benefit or Global Entry fee credit should be timed accordingly. 

Points generally cannot be transferred to airline or hotel partners under this program, so travelers who prioritize partner transfers might prefer a different ecosystem.
